WebMar 4, 2024 · The remains of a US Air Force Base are on the west coast. This US Air Force tracking station in Grand Turk began in the early 1950s and closed in 1984. On February 20, 1962, astronaut John Glenn, in the Project Mercury Space Programme, became the first American to orbit the earth. Inside visit: No ... sharegate guidanceWebNov 10, 2016 · A more mundane journey for the capsule was the one it took on Grand Turk. The USS Randolph brought the capsule to the shores of Grand Turk. It then took its final sea journey on a small launch, which brought it to the Grand Turk dock.
